Log message:
	Calculate mirror log size instead of hardcoding 1 extent size.
	
	It fails for 1k PE now.
	
	Patch adds log_region_size into allocation habdle struct
	and use it in _alloc_parallel_area() for proper log size calculation
	instead of hardcoded 1 extent - which can fail.
	
	Reproducer for incorrect log size calculation:
	DEV=/dev/sd[bcd]
	
	pvcreate $DEV
	vgcreate -s 1k vg_test $DEV
	lvcreate -m1 -L 12M -n mirr vg_test
	
	https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=477040
	
	The log size calculation is mostly copied from kernel code.

@@ -704,6 +707,28 @@
 }
 
 /*
+ * Returns log device size in extents, algorithm from kernel code
+ */
+#define BYTE_SHIFT 3
+static uint32_t mirror_log_extents(uint32_t region_size, uint32_t pe_size, uint32_t area_len)
+{
+	size_t area_size, bitset_size, log_size, region_count;
+
+	area_size = area_len * pe_size;
+	region_count = dm_div_up(area_size, region_size);
+
+	/* Work out how many "unsigned long"s we need to hold the bitset. */
+	bitset_size = dm_round_up(region_count, sizeof(uint32_t) << BYTE_SHIFT);
+	bitset_size >>= BYTE_SHIFT;
+
+	/* Log device holds both header and bitset. */
+	log_size = dm_round_up((MIRROR_LOG_OFFSET << SECTOR_SHIFT) + bitset_size, 1 << SECTOR_SHIFT);
+	log_size >>= SECTOR_SHIFT;
+
+	return dm_div_up(log_size, pe_size);
+}
+
